Understanding the psychology of the color yellow
Association with positivity and happiness
Yellow is often associated with positivity, happiness, and energy. It is a bright and cheerful color that can instantly uplift one’s mood. When people see the color yellow, it triggers feelings of joy and optimism. This is why yellow is often used in marketing and branding to convey a sense of happiness and positivity.
Impact on mood and emotions
The color yellow has been found to have a significant impact on mood and emotions. Studies have shown that exposure to the color yellow can increase feelings of happiness and reduce feelings of depression. It is also believed to stimulate mental activity and enhance creativity. This is why yellow is often used in spaces where productivity and creativity are important, such as offices and classrooms.
Cultural significance of yellow
Yellow holds different cultural significance around the world. In Western cultures, yellow is often associated with sunshine, warmth, and happiness. It is also commonly used to represent caution or warning. In Eastern cultures, yellow is a symbol of spirituality and enlightenment. In some cultures, yellow is associated with royalty and prosperity. Understanding the cultural significance of yellow can help in effectively using this color in various contexts.
Choosing the right shades of yellow
When it comes to making the color yellow pop, choosing the right shade is crucial. The shade of yellow you choose can greatly impact the overall look and feel of your design.
Bright vs. muted yellows
Bright yellows are vibrant and eye-catching, making them perfect for creating a bold statement. They work well in designs where you want to grab attention or evoke a sense of energy and excitement. On the other hand, muted yellows are more subdued and relaxing. They can add a touch of warmth and coziness to your design without being too overwhelming.
Warm vs. cool yellows
Warm yellows have undertones of orange and red, giving them a sunny and inviting feel. They are great for creating a welcoming atmosphere and can be used to add a pop of color to a space. Cool yellows, on the other hand, have undertones of green and blue, giving them a more calming and serene vibe. They work well in designs where you want to create a sense of tranquility and relaxation.
Complementary color combinations
To make yellow pop even more, consider pairing it with complementary colors. Some great color combinations include yellow and purple, yellow and blue, or yellow and gray. These combinations create a visually appealing contrast that can make the yellow stand out even more. Experiment with different color combinations to find the one that works best for your design.
Incorporating yellow into your design or decor
Yellow is a bright and cheerful color that can add a pop of energy to any room. Whether you’re looking to create a bold statement or simply liven up a space, incorporating yellow into your design or decor can be a great way to achieve the desired effect.
Using yellow as an accent color
One of the easiest ways to incorporate yellow into your design is by using it as an accent color. This can be done through small touches such as throw pillows, artwork, or decorative objects. Yellow accents can help to add a touch of warmth and brightness to a space without overwhelming the overall design.
Creating focal points with yellow
Another way to make the color yellow pop in your design is by creating focal points with it. This can be achieved through larger pieces of furniture or statement pieces such as a yellow sofa or a yellow accent wall. By using yellow in a prominent way, you can draw attention to specific areas of a room and create visual interest.
Balancing yellow with other colors
While yellow can be a vibrant and eye-catching color, it’s important to balance it with other colors to create a cohesive design. Consider pairing yellow with neutrals such as white, grey, or black to create a modern and sophisticated look. Or, for a more playful feel, try combining yellow with other bright colors such as blue, green, or pink. Experimenting with different color combinations can help you find the perfect balance for your design.
Tips for making yellow pop in photographs
Utilizing natural light
One of the best ways to make the color yellow stand out in photographs is to take advantage of natural light. Natural light can bring out the vibrancy and warmth of yellow hues, making them pop in your images. Try shooting during the golden hour, which is the hour after sunrise and before sunset when the light is soft and warm. Position your subject in a way that the natural light hits the yellow elements in your composition, highlighting them beautifully.
Enhancing saturation and contrast
Another effective way to make yellow pop in photographs is by enhancing the saturation and contrast of the image. You can do this by adjusting the levels in post-processing software like Photoshop or Lightroom. Increase the saturation of the yellows to make them more vibrant and eye-catching. You can also play around with the contrast to make the yellow elements stand out against the rest of the image.
Experimenting with different angles and compositions
To make yellow pop in your photographs, try experimenting with different angles and compositions. Get creative with your shots by trying out unique perspectives or compositions that emphasize the yellow elements in your image. Play around with the framing of your subject to draw attention to the yellow hues. Don’t be afraid to try out unconventional angles or compositions to make the color yellow really stand out in your photographs.
